The Powell Doctrine proffers a list of questions where all must be answered affirmatively before military action is taken by the United States: [7]

 

[1] Is a vital national security interest threatened?

 

[2] Do we have a clear attainable objective?

 

[3] Have the risks and costs been fully and frankly analyzed?

 

[4] Have all other non-violent policy means been fully exhausted?

 

[5] Is there a plausible exit strategy to avoid endless entanglement?

 

[6] Have the consequences of our action been fully considered?

 

[7] Is the action supported by the American people?

 

[8] Do we have genuine broad international support?
